About
Silver Lake Golf Course sits along Staten Island's North Shore, offering a scenic and challenging layout that is one of the five boroughs' best-kept secrets. The course has a classic layout with postage stamp-sized greens and narrow fairways. At just over 6,000 yards from the back tees, the golf course appears shorter than it plays. The tight layout demands accuracy throughout especially on the lengthier holes, of which there are several. The course offers interesting risk-reward opportunities and holes 12 through 14 are considered by locals the "Amen Corner" of the North. The entire layout will test your shot-making abilities. In addition to the challenging round, Silver Lake is known for having consistently excellent conditions with some of New York's best greens, which is why it has garnered a strong following among local players.
